    The SAP error message /SAPAPO/AHT400 is related to the Advanced Planning and Optimization (APO) module in SAP. This message typically indicates that there are issues with the actions that are being processed in the APO system, particularly in the context of the Advanced Planning and Scheduling (APS) functionalities.

    Cause:

    The error message can be triggered by various factors, including but not limited to:

    1. Data Inconsistencies: There may be inconsistencies in the master data or transaction data that the APO system is trying to process.
    2. Configuration Issues: Incorrect configuration settings in the APO system can lead to errors when executing certain actions.
    3. Missing Authorizations: The user executing the action may not have the necessary authorizations to perform the action.
    4. System Performance: If the system is under heavy load or if there are performance issues, it may lead to timeouts or failures in processing actions.
    5. Custom Code: If there are custom enhancements or modifications in the APO system, they may not be functioning as expected.

    Solution:

    To resolve the /SAPAPO/AHT400 error, you can take the following steps:

    1. Check Logs: Review the application logs and system logs for more detailed error messages that can provide insights into the specific cause of the issue.
    2. Data Validation: Ensure that all relevant master data (like materials, resources, etc.) and transaction data (like demand and supply) are consistent and correctly maintained.
    3. Configuration Review: Verify the configuration settings in the APO system to ensure they are set up correctly for the actions you are trying to perform.
    4. User Authorizations: Check the user roles and authorizations to ensure that the user has the necessary permissions to execute the actions.
    5. Performance Monitoring: Monitor system performance and check for any bottlenecks that may be affecting the processing of actions.
    6.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or notes related to the specific version of APO you are using for any known issues or patches.
    7.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ists, consider reaching out to SAP support for assistance, providing them with detailed information about the error and the context in which it occurred.
